Weather in August

The last month of the summer, August, is another hot month in Marion Junction, Alabama, with temperature in the range of an average high of 91.8°F (33.2°C) and an average low of 72°F (22.2°C).

Temperature

The start of August sees the average high-temperature at a still tropical 91.8°F (33.2°C), showing little difference from July's 92.1°F (33.4°C). Marion Junction's average low-temperature is measured at an agreeable 72°F (22.2°C) during August.

Heat index

In August, the heat index is estimated at a burning hot 114.8°F (46°C). Take heed: Heat exhaustion and heat cramps are anticipated. Heatstroke is a potential outcome of continuous activity.
When assessing, remember that heat index measurements are for light winds and shaded spots. The heat index could see an increase by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ees under direct sunshine.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'felt air temperature' or 'real feel', is calculated by taking the relative humidity value for a specific location and factoring it into the air temperature reading. This effect tends to be personal, with the weather perception differing among individuals due to variations in body mass, height, and exertion. It is noteworthy that being in direct sunlight can enhance the weather's impact, raising the heat index by as much as 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are highly critical to babies and toddlers. Youngsters typically face more danger than adults since they sweat less. Their larger skin surface compared to their small bodies and heightened heat production from their activities augment their vulnerability.
The human body has a built-in cooling mechanism through perspiration; evaporating sweat dissipates the excess heat. When there is an excess of moisture in the atmosphere, the efficiency of the evaporation process is lessened, leading to less efficient body cooling and a sensation of overheating. When body heat isn't effectively managed, risks of dehydration and overheating amplify.

Humidity

In Marion Junction, the average relative humidity in August is 74%.

Rainfall

In August, the rain falls for 19.9 days. Throughout August, 3.54" (90mm) of precipitation is accumulated. Throughout the year, there are 165 rainfall days, and 37.17" (944mm) of precipitation is accumulated.

Snowfall

April through November are months without snowfall.

Daylight

In Marion Junction, the average length of the day in August is 13h and 19min.
On the first day of August, sunrise is at 6:04 am and sunset at 7:46 pm.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 6:23 am and sunset at 7:14 pm CDT.

Sunshine

The average sunshine in August in Marion Junction is 10.2h.

UV index

The months with the highest UV index in Marion Junction are June through August, with an average maximum UV index of 7. A UV Index value of 6 to 7 symbolizes a high health hazard from exposure to the Sun's UV rays for ordinary individuals.
Note: The maximum daily UV index, 7 in August, converts into the following recommendations:
Avoid overexposure. Fair-skinned individuals can burn in under 20 minutes. During the period from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m., UV radiation is highest. Try to avoid direct sunlight during these hours. For holistic sun protection encompassing the eyes, ears, face, and neck, a wide-brim hat is key.
